How much do entry level human resources jobs pay per year?

As of Jul 14, 2026, the average yearly pay for entry level human resources in Riverside, CA is $46,159.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$39,100.00 and $50,100.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

Is HR a high burnout job?

Entry level Human Resources roles can experience high burnout due to handling employee conflicts, compliance issues, and workload pressures. The job often requires strong communication skills and managing stressful situations, which can contribute to fatigue if not balanced properly.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an Entry Level Human Resources professional,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Entry Level Human Resources professional, you need a foundational understanding of HR principles, basic employment law, and strong organizational skills, often supported by a bachelor's degree in human resources or a related field. Familiarity with HR information systems (HRIS), applicant tracking systems, and Microsoft Office Suite is typically expected. Strong interpersonal skills, attention to detail, and the ability to maintain confidentiality help you stand out in this role. These skills are crucial for ensuring accurate HR processes, effective communication, and the smooth handling of sensitive employee matters.

What are entry level human resources jobs?

Entry level human resources jobs are positions designed for individuals beginning their careers in HR. These roles typically involve tasks such as assisting with recruitment, onboarding new employees, maintaining employee records, and supporting HR projects. Common entry level titles include HR Assistant, HR Coordinator, or HR Administrator. These jobs provide valuable exposure to various HR functions and are a great starting point for building a career in human resources.

How to enter HR with no experience?

Entry-level Human Resources positions often accept candidates with little or no experience if they demonstrate strong communication, organizational skills, and a willingness to learn. Gaining relevant certifications like the SHRM-CP or completing internships can improve your chances and provide practical knowledge of HR functions. Building familiarity with HR software and understanding employment laws can also be beneficial.

What are some common challenges faced by entry-level HR professionals, and how can they effectively address them?

Entry-level HR professionals often encounter challenges such as balancing administrative tasks with learning new HR processes, handling confidential information, and adapting to a fast-paced work environment. To effectively address these challenges, it’s important to stay organized, seek mentorship from experienced team members, and proactively ask questions to gain a deeper understanding of HR policies and systems. Building strong communication skills and being open to feedback can also help new HR professionals grow quickly in their roles and contribute to the team.

Can I apply for an HR position with no experience?

Entry-level Human Resources positions often do not require prior experience and may focus on skills such as communication, organization, and basic knowledge of employment laws. Candidates can improve their chances by obtaining relevant certifications like the SHRM-CP or completing internships to gain practical exposure.

What is the most entry-level HR job?

The most entry-level HR job is typically an HR assistant or HR coordinator. These roles involve supporting HR functions such as onboarding, record-keeping, and administrative tasks, often requiring basic computer skills and a high school diploma or equivalent.

Summary:The Human Resources team support Sorenson Engineering by delivering proactive, responsive, and strategic people practices. This role manages day-to-day HR functions with a focus on employee support, compliance, and continuous improvement. Works closely with management to develop and maintain a high-performance workplace culture grounded in professionalism, accountability, and respect. This position is in-person only and requires consistent presence to serve the needs of employees and leadership.

Level I: Entry-level: administers general HR procedures and supports onboarding, employee file maintenance, and employee inquiries.

Essential Job Functions:

  • Supports the full employee lifecycle including onboarding, performance reviews, employee relations, and offboarding.
  • Maintains accurate HR records, data entry and reporting.
  • Ensures compliance with local, state, and federal laws including but not limited to wage & hour, benefits, leaves of absence, and workplace safety regulations.
  • Addresses employee relations issues promptly and professionally.
  • Assists with payroll, benefits administration, and compensation reviews.
  • Participates in HR audits, compliance activities, and internal initiatives (e.g., training).
  • Maintains and communicates the employee handbook, company policies, and procedures.
  • Oversees and supports timekeeping systems and ensures compliance with wage and hour regulations.artners with safety and facilities teams to support workplace safety initiatives.
  • Maintain exemplary attendance, punctuality, and professional conduct.
  • Operates fully on-site and provides in-person support across all departments.
  • Performs other duties as required and assigned.

Knowledge and Abilities:

  • Solid understanding of HR best practices and employment law
  • Strong communication and interpersonal skills
  • Organized, detail-oriented, and able to maintain confidentiality
  • Proficient with Microsoft Office and HRIS/ATS platforms
  • Bilingual (Spanish) preferred
  • Strong conflict resolution, mediation, and negotiation skills to manage and de-escalate workplace issues effectively
  • High emotional intelligence with the ability to navigate complex interpersonal dynamics and maintain employee trust
  • Experience supporting change initiatives and helping teams adapt to evolving business

Education and Experience:

Bachelor's degree in business or related field preferred. Experience in a Human Resources function, preferably in a manufacturing environment.

Physical Demands:

  • Prolonged periods of sitting at a desk and working on a computer
  • Must be able to access and navigate each department of the facility
  • Must occasionally exert push force up to 20 pounds
  • Must have good eyesight and hand dexterity, and be able to identify and distinguish colors

Work Environment:

Within safety guidelines, there will be exposed to noise, moving mechanical parts, oils/solvents, fumes, and odors that may affect the eyes, ears, nose, throat and/or skin.
